简 介: 在Windows下下载Aprilttags检测工具包,对于图片中的Apriltag检测进行了初步的实验。关键词: Apriltag
Apriltag检测
目 录
Contents
软件安装
基本测试
在使用 Python 进行开发时,提高代码提示的准确性和效率是至关重要的。本文将详细介绍如何在 Python 开发环境中设置代码提示,包括使用 IDE 进行配置以及一些相关的最佳实践。
### 一、选择合适的 IDE
在设置代码提示之前,选择合适的集成开发环境(IDE)是关键。以下是一些在 Python 开发中受欢迎的 IDE:
| IDE | 特点
原创
2024-09-01 04:07:51
261阅读
# Tab 格式解析 Java 代码的实现指南
在这篇文章中,我们将一起探讨如何实现一个简单的“tab格式解析Java代码”的功能。这个解析器的最终目标是从一段Java代码中提取结构化的信息,并确保代码的缩进在解析过程中得以保留。我们将按步骤走过整个过程,并在实现时提供代码示例和详细的解释。
## 整体流程
我们可以将整个解析过程分解为以下几个步骤:
| 步骤编号 | 步骤描述
原创
2024-09-18 05:03:24
51阅读
python是一种功能强大和适用面很广的开发语言,在大数据应用和机器学习日益流行的年代,python凭借其简洁、易用和可扩展性获得很多用户的支持,近年来使用率高速增长。python环境下,集成了科学计算扩展库:NumPy、SciPy和matplotlib,它们分别为Python提供了快速数组处理、数值运算以及绘图功能。因此Python语言及其众多的扩展库所构成的开发环境十分适合工程技术、科研人员处
转载
2023-09-17 10:20:57
59阅读
# Python IDE 安装与使用指南
在软件开发过程中,选择合适的开发环境是至关重要的。对于Python开发者来说,使用合适的IDE(集成开发环境)能够大大提升代码编写效率。本文将带你了解如何找到和使用一个流行的Python IDE——PyCharm。
## 流程概览
我们将以表格的形式展示整个流程,帮助你清晰了解操作步骤。
| 步骤编号 | 操作内容 |
MRT7-Python软件是一款Python少儿编程软件,分为图块Boclky 编程模式、Python代码编程模式,同时也可以配合设备使用!软件使用都不是很困难,用户只需要根据自己的系统选择安装版本即可。功能介绍图块Boclky 编程模式,如图1:文件操作区域 打开--打开文件内容 保存---保存文件 新建---新建文件2:编程模式切换区域 图块--Blockly 编程模式 Python--Pyt
# PythonIDEA:社区版的Python开发工具
Python,作为一种广泛使用的编程语言,因其简洁的语法和强大的功能而受到开发者的喜爱。然而,对于初学者来说,选择合适的开发工具至关重要。PythonIDEA,作为Python开发工具的社区版本,以其轻量级、易于使用和丰富的功能,成为了众多开发者的首选。
## PythonIDEA社区版简介
PythonIDEA社区版是一个开源的Pyt
原创
2024-07-19 13:30:47
55阅读
pythonidea是一款旨在提高Python开发效率的集成开发环境(IDE),它为开发者提供了众多强大的功能支持。自推出以来,pythonidea不断更新迭代,致力于为Python开发者提供无缝的开发体验。本文将深入探讨pythonidea的工作原理、架构解析、源码分析、性能优化及应用场景。
### 背景描述
在2020年,随着Python语言在数据科学、人工智能和Web开发领域的崛起,越来
# 在Python中使用断点调试程序的方法
## 引言
在开发过程中,经常会遇到程序出现bug或者逻辑错误的情况。为了解决这些问题,我们可以使用断点来调试程序。Python作为一种高级编程语言,提供了丰富的调试工具,其中之一就是使用`pythonidea`来设置断点。
## 什么是断点?
断点是程序中的一个指定位置,当程序运行到这个位置时会暂停执行,以便我们对程序进行调试。通过在断点位置观察变
原创
2024-01-06 06:08:58
73阅读
# Python中引入依赖的方法
在Python中,我们可以通过多种方式来引入依赖,以扩展Python的功能。本文将介绍三种常用的方法:使用`pip`包管理器、直接引入标准库和第三方库、以及使用虚拟环境来管理依赖。
## 1. 使用pip包管理器
pip是Python的包管理器,使用它可以方便地安装、升级和删除Python包。以下是使用pip安装依赖的步骤:
1. 打开命令行或终端窗口。
原创
2023-10-11 11:28:35
52阅读
今天推荐一个Python学习的干货。几个印度小哥,在GitHub上建了一个各种Python算法的新手入门大全,现在标星已经超过2.6万。这个项目主要包括两部分内容:一是各种算法的基本原理讲解,二是各种算法的代码实现。简单介绍下。算法的基本原理讲解部分,包括排序算法、搜索算法、插值算法、跳跃搜索算法、快速选择算法、禁忌搜索算法、加密算法等。这部分内容,主要介绍各种不同算法的原理,其中不少介绍还给出了
转载
2023-07-20 12:48:11
34阅读
1, TAB补全代码#!/usr/bin/python
#pyton startup file
import sys
import readline
import rlcompleter
import atexit
import os
#tab completion
readline.parse_and_b
原创
2015-07-14 23:11:36
782阅读
1 简介全称Knuth-Morris-Pratt算法,在计算机科学中,Knuth-Morris-Pratt字符串查找算法(简称为KMP算法)可在一个主文本字符串内查找一个词的出现位置。此算法通过运用对这个词在不匹配时本身就包含足够的信息来确定下一个匹配将在哪里开始的发现,从而避免重新检查先前匹配的字符。这个算法是由高德纳和沃恩·普拉特在1974年构思,同年詹姆斯·H·莫里斯也独立地设计出该算法,最
转载
2024-08-12 15:18:47
74阅读
# Python中Tab键代码实现指南
在Python编程中,Tab键的实现通常与文本编辑、用户输入界面等有关。使用Tab键可以让我们的代码更为整齐美观,甚至在某些场景下提高用户体验。在这篇文章中,我将详细教你如何实现“Python Tab键代码”,并提供必要的代码示例和说明。本文的结构如下:
## 实现步骤概览
| 步骤 | 描述
# Python中的Tab和空格的格式
在编写Python代码时,代码的格式非常重要。其中,一个很常见的问题就是关于代码缩进的格式,即使用Tab键还是空格。在Python中,代码的缩进非常重要,因为它表示代码块的开始和结束。在Python中,代码块是根据缩进来划分的,而不是像其他语言一样使用大括号。因此,正确的缩进格式可以让代码更加清晰易读。
## Tab和空格的区别
在Python中,Ta
原创
2024-03-24 06:10:57
483阅读
1. 问题 今天更换电脑了,在新电脑上安装我最喜欢的python小工具ipython,当我尝试使用时… 我的自动补全呢,。。。。。。。,回车还会报错,我的妈呀,这。。。要气死我哦 2. 解决过程(可以跳过哦) 再网上查阅了相关的资料发现是最新的ipython 7.19.0无法使用jedi 0.18.
转载
2021-01-18 11:44:00
410阅读
# Java中的Tab键过滤:解决输入处理中的常见问题
在Java应用程序开发中,处理用户输入时,经常会遇到一些特殊字符,比如Tab键。Tab键通常用于在不同的输入字段之间跳转,但在某些情况下,我们需要阻止Tab键的输入,以确保用户输入的格式正确。本文将详细介绍如何在Java中过滤Tab键,通过示例代码来实现,并提供状态图和关系图帮助理解整个过程。
## 1. 问题描述
在文本框或其他输入组
原创
2024-09-08 06:28:04
64阅读
# 如何实现jquery tab切换代码
## 概述
在网页开发中,tab切换是一种常见的交互效果,通过点击不同的标签页来展示对应的内容。本文将向你介绍如何使用jquery实现tab切换功能,帮助你更好地理解和掌握这一技术。
## 整体流程
首先,我们来看一下实现jquery tab切换的整体流程:
| 步骤 | 操作 |
| --- | --- |
| 1 | 创建HTML结构 |
| 2
原创
2024-04-23 06:05:12
244阅读
在 iOS 开发中,Tab 切换是一个常见的需求,通过合适的代码实现可以极大地提升用户体验。我们本篇文章将以轻松的语气记录解决“iOS Tab 切换代码”这一问题的整个过程,涉及的内容包括环境配置、编译过程、参数调优、定制开发、性能对比和进阶指南。让我们一起探索吧!
## 环境配置
首先,我们需要配置好 iOS 开发环境。确保你的机器上安装了以下工具:
1. **Xcode**(版本 12及
以下为社区版和专业版区别,官网上有说明:一,本次教程系统配置1.WIN10 64位 2.8GB内存 3.SSD固态硬盘 4.屏幕分辨率:1920x1080 5.Python版本:Python3.8.3 6.PyCharm版本:PyCharm2020.1.2二,PyCharm2020.1.2安装系统配置要求1.Win8或Win10 64位 2.最小2GB内存,建议8GB内存 3.至少2.